
![]() | Mary Somerville was born in 1780. She didn't have much education and didn't become interested in algebra until she was over 14 years old. She married twice, both times to her cousins. Her first husband didn't support her in her math studies. The second one did. She was the first woman to have her paper read to the Royal Society. The paper was "The Magnetic Properties of the Violet Rays of the solar System". In 1835 she and another woman were the first women to be elected in the Royal Astronomical Society. It was a great honor to receive. She died in 1872 at the age of 92. |
